Navi AMC Unveils Nifty MidSmallcap 400 Index Fund for Investors

Navi AMC, the asset management arm of Navi Ltd, has launched the Navi Nifty MidSmallcap 400 Index Fund, an open-ended index fund that seeks to replicate and track the Nifty MidSmallcap 400 Index.

The New Fund Offer (NFO) opened on November 24, 2025 and will remain available for subscription till December 5, 2025. Investors can begin investing with a minimum amount of ₹100.

The scheme brings together the Nifty Midcap 150 and Nifty Smallcap 250 indices, covering 400 companies within the broader Nifty 500 universe. The fund will track the index’s Total Return variant, which accounts for dividends along with price movements. Constructed using a free-float market capitalisation-weighted methodology, the index is maintained and periodically rebalanced by NSE Indices.

“Mid- and small-cap companies have been at the forefront of India’s growth story, yet accessing this segment in a diversified and cost-efficient manner has remained a challenge for many investors. With the Navi Nifty MidSmallcap 400 Index Fund, we are offering a simple way to participate in this opportunity through a single, broad-based index. Our focus is on creating transparent, rules-based products that help investors build long-term wealth without complexity, Aditya Mulki, CEO, Navi AMC, said.
